Citations
1 citation on file for this inspection.
1910.132 A
- Issued
- Mar 14, 2016
- Penalty
- Initial $7,000 · Current $5,000 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.132(a): Protective equipment, including personal protective equipment for eyes, face, head, and extremities, protective clothing, respiratory devices, and protective shields and barriers, were not provided, used, and maintained in a sanitary and reliable condition: a) 3rd floor of BOP shop, 'R' vessel hood, Braddock Avenue and 13th Street, Braddock, PA 15104: On or about September 16, 2015, the employer did not ensure that fall protection was provided, used and maintained by employees who were engaged in cleaning activities on the Jbends and header areas of the 'R' vessel hood. The employees were exposed to a fall hazard of approximately 58 feet to the pit below while cleaning the third floor of the BOP shop near the 'R' vessel hood and while accessing the header area from the third floor of the BOP shop.
